Job Details

Job Details:

We are in search of a highly skilled and experienced CNC Manufacturing Engineer to join our dynamic team. This is a permanent position that offers a unique opportunity to work in an innovative, fast-paced environment where you can apply your expertise in CNC programming, AS1900, CAM Programming, and ISO9001. The successful candidate will be a key player in our manufacturing process, with a primary focus on the design, development, and optimization of our CNC machining processes. The role offers a chance to work with cutting-edge technology and contribute to the creation of high-quality products.

Responsibilities:

1. Develop, implement, and optimize CNC programs to create complex parts using CAD/CAM software.
2. Oversee the entire manufacturing process, from initial design to final production, ensuring compliance with specifications and quality standards.
3. Perform root cause analysis on manufacturing process failures and implement corrective actions.
4. Continuously evaluate and improve machining processes, tooling, and fixtures to increase productivity, efficiency, and quality.
5.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to resolve manufacturing and quality problems, and to develop and implement cost-effective solutions.
6. Train and guide machine operators on new CNC programs and processes.
7. Ensure all manufacturing processes adhere to safety regulations and maintain ISO9001 standards.
8. Conduct regular inspections and audits to ensure equipment is properly maintained and calibrated.
9. Stay up-to-date with the latest manufacturing technologies and trends, and make recommendations for improvements.

Qualifications:

1.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, or a related field.
2. Minimum of 5 years' experience in CNC programming, including experience with CAD/CAM software.
3. Solid knowledge of AS1900 and ISO9001 standards.
4. Proven experience in CAM programming.
5. Strong understanding of manufacturing processes, machining operations, and quality control procedures.
6. Excellent problem-solving abilities and attention to detail.
7.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work effectively in a team environment.
8. Proficiency in using Microsoft Office Suite and other relevant software.
9. Ability to read and interpret technical drawings and blueprints.
10. Strong project management skills, with the ability to handle multiple projects simultaneously and meet tight deadlines.
